HOT CROSS BUNS AND MEDITATION - EMG ' S EASTER SERVICE

HYMNS , PRAYERS AND AN INSPIRING SERMON
Just under 100 East Melbourne Glen Chapter members and guests flocked to the Cardinal Pavilion on Tuesday 4 April , a beautiful , sunny autumn day , for the EMG Easter Service .
Director of Development , Tim Shearer (’ 85 ) introduced EMG Chairman , Ken Jasper (’ 55 ), who welcomed all attendees , including Scotch ’ s oldest known living Old Boy , 107-year old Bill Morgan (’ 34 ). Among the guests were the Principal , Dr Scott Marsh and Mrs Anna Marsh , former School Council Chairman David Crawford AO (’ 61 ), former maths and physics teacher and Registrar , David Scott ( staff 1948-98 ) and former OSCA Executive Director , Leigh McGregor (’ 55 ) and his wife , Ros .
Ken Jasper introduced OSCA Chaplain , Graham Bradbeer , who conducted the call to worship . Bible readings were by Dr
Marsh ( Matthew 28 : 1-20 ) and Ken Jasper ( 1 Corinthians 15 : 1-9 ).
Three traditional hymns were sung during the service , well accompanied by Steve Manders (’ 73 ) on the piano – Crown Him with Many Crowns , Amazing Grace and Thine be the Glory .
Graham Bradbeer ’ s inspiring sermon was entitled ‘ Faith and its difficulties ’. He spoke of four facets of faith – ‘ doubts , develops , delivers and delights ’:
� Doubts – there are numerous examples of faith asking questions and seeking strength . Thomas the disciple is the patron saint of doubters .
� Develops – the personal challenges of the Christian faith call for development of a new character – a kind of ‘ new man ’
� Delivers – faith or trust centred on Jesus Christ delivers the challenge of a life based
on faith , hope and love . These were the central elements in Christ ’ s Passion .
� Delights – in the end we will behold the face of the One who loved us with everlasting love , and gave Himself for us .
Graham concluded the service with a prayer and benediction . Morning tea of hot cross buns , chocolates , coffee and tea was the ideal way to conclude the service , as guests mingled and conversed .
It is hoped that the EMG Easter Service will return to the Littlejohn Memorial Chapel in 2024 .
The service was very well organised by Foundation Coordinator , Rebecca Mortimer , and Bequest Program Manager , Sandra Dick .
